Ceisteanna—Questions. Oral Answers. - Limerick Higher Diploma Course.

206.

asked the Minister for Education if he will take steps to ensure that the higher diploma in education course is retained in Limerick.

207.

asked the Minister for Education if, in view of the decision of the Governing Body of University College, Cork, to withdraw facilities for the higher diploma in education course from the Mary Immaculate College, Limerick, and the resulting repercussions on the city of Limerick and the region, he will now takes steps to provide sufficient qualified personnel to continue this course.

208.

andMr. Daly asked the Minister for Education if he will inquire into the decision of University College, Cork, to discontinue the Limerick-based course leading to the higher diploma in education.

209.

asked the Minister for Education if he will ensure that the higher diploma in education course in Limerick will not be terminated.

With the permission of the Ceann Comhairle, I propose to take Questions Nos. 206, 207, 208 and 209 together.

The decision in relation to the higher diploma in education course in Limerck conducted by University College, Cork, is one for the university college authorities and is not subject to the agreement of the Minister for Education.

Is it not possible that if sufficient subvention were available for University College, Cork, the course might be continued?

That appears to be a separate question.

With respect, I submit that it is a question that arises logically from this series of questions.

It is a separate question.

If I might frame it, then, in a different way. Would the Minister not agree, seeing that the major part of university finance comes from central funds, that he might make an allocation to University College, Cork, for the purpose of continuing and adequately staffing the higher diploma course at Limerick?

I think that is a separate question and one which could be put down appropriately for separate answer.
